Neighborhood Overview

Kewadin Casino in St. Ignace is strategically located on the Upper Peninsula's southern tip, just off I-75, making it a convenient stop for travelers crossing the Mackinac Bridge. The casino sits along the Mackinac Trail, a primary artery serving the St. Ignace area. Its proximity to the bridge means quick access to Mackinac Island and Mackinaw City via a short drive. The nearest major airport is Pellston Regional Airport (PLN), located about 45 minutes south by car, though Traverse City's Cherry Capital Airport (TVC) offers more flight options and is about a 2.5-hour drive away. Driving is the most common way to reach St. Ignace, with I-75 providing direct access. Public transportation is limited, so rideshares or personal vehicles are recommended for exploring beyond the casino's immediate vicinity. Smart arrival tactics involve planning your route to avoid peak bridge traffic, especially during holiday weekends or summer vacation periods.

Mackinac Bridge Museum

0.1 mi

Located very close to the casino, this museum offers fascinating insights into the construction and history of the iconic Mackinac Bridge. Exhibits include photographs, artifacts, and stories from the people who built this engineering marvel. It's a quick and informative stop for anyone interested in local history and infrastructure. The proximity makes it an easy add-on to a casino visit, especially for those who enjoy learning about regional landmarks.

Father Marquette National Memorial & Museum

1.3 mi

This historical site commemorates Father Jacques Marquette, a renowned French Jesuit explorer and missionary who founded St. Ignace. The memorial features a statue and museum detailing his life and explorations in the Great Lakes region. It offers a peaceful and educational experience, providing context to the area's rich historical significance. The location also provides scenic views and a quiet place for reflection.

Local Tips

Traffic on US-2 and I-75 can be heavy during summer weekends and holiday periods: plan travel accordingly.

St. Ignace experiences a significant seasonal shift: activities and dining options may be reduced in the off-season.

Many local businesses close by 9 or 10 PM: , so plan evening dining or entertainment outside the casino with this in mind.

The downtown area is best explored on foot: , but parking can be challenging during peak tourist season.

Seasonal note: St. Ignace thrives during the summer months, with the casino and surrounding attractions buzzing with activity. Spring and fall offer milder weather and fewer crowds, making it ideal for scenic drives and exploring historical sites. Winter brings a quieter, snow-covered landscape, where the casino remains a warm, lively hub, but outdoor recreational options are limited to snowmobiling or ice fishing for the adventurous. The ferry services to Mackinac Island operate seasonally, with reduced schedules in the colder months.
